By Marina Ortiz

On Sunday, June 29th, 33 Mujeres NYC x Oscar went to Williamsburg, Brooklyn to spread the word about the campaign to free Puerto Rican political prisoner Oscar López Rivera!  Standing in front of the Marcy Street Station on Broadway just over the Williamsburg Bridge, las mujeres and their allies captured the attention of local residents with strong chants and large signs. Supporters stood nearby with petitions in hand to engage passersby.

33 Mujeres NYC x Oscar is a group of NYC women committed to securing Oscar’s freedom. Inspired by the work that 32 Mujeres x Oscar have been doing in San Juan, Puerto Rico since 2012, we hold similar monthly rallies for 33 minutes on the last Sunday of every month to signify the 33 years that Oscar has been imprisoned.
